RF Flange

Industrial equipment in Rock Hill, United States
Suggest an edit · Your business? Claim now

Add more information

Commercial Filtration Supply has deep roots in industrial filtration. We are Authorized Filtration Distributor's that stock Major Brands: Eaton, Titan, …

Social profiles